What is xeunciM 1200 Pill?

XeunciM 1200 Pill is a medication that contains a combination of Dextromethorphan Hydrobromide and Guaifenesin Extended-Release. It primarily treats coughs and congestion associated with respiratory tract infections. Ohm Laboratories Inc. markets the white-colored oval-shaped pill available only with a prescription from a healthcare provider.

Dextromethorphan Hydrobromide is an antitussive medication that works by suppressing coughs. It does this by acting on the cough center in the brain to decrease the frequency and intensity of coughing.

On the other hand, Guaifenesin Extended-Release is an expectorant that works by thinning mucus secretions, making it easier to cough up phlegm and clear the airways.

The recommended dosage of XeunciM 1200 Pill depends on factors such as the patient’s age, weight, medical condition, and response to treatment. It is essential to follow the instructions provided by your healthcare provider or the medication label carefully.

Taking more than the recommended dose can result in serious side effects such as dizziness, drowsiness, nausea, vomiting, and respiratory depression.

Drug Interactions

As with any medication, it is essential to understand the potential drug interactions of XeunciM 1200 Pill before taking it. Some of the known drug interactions include:

  • Monoamine oxidase inhibitors (MAOIs): Taking XeunciM 1200 Pill with MAOIs can increase the risk of serotonin syndrome, a potentially life-threatening condition.
  • Antidepressants: Combining XeunciM 1200 Pill with certain antidepressants can also increase the risk of serotonin syndrome.
  • Blood thinners: Guaifenesin, one of the ingredients in XeunciM 1200 Pill, can increase the risk of bleeding when taken with blood thinners like warfarin or heparin.
  • Sedatives: Dextromethorphan, another ingredient in XeunciM 1200 Pill, can interact with sedatives like benzodiazepines or alcohol to cause excessive drowsiness or respiratory depression.
  • Stimulants: Taking XeunciM 1200 Pill with stimulants like caffeine or amphetamines can increase the risk of side effects like increased heart rate or blood pressure.

It is essential to talk to your healthcare provider about any medications or supplements you are currently taking before starting XeunciM 1200 Pill to minimize the risk of drug interactions.
